WebBorder Collie: Bred for herding sheep in the British Isles in all weather conditions, use eye stalking and movement. Corgi: Pembroke Welsh Corgis and Cardigan Welsh Corgis are one of the oldest herding breeds and were bred to nip at the legs of sheep, geese, ducks, horses, and cattle.
